Retroactive Withdrawal

Retroactive withdrawal

A retroactive withdrawal is available only in extraordinary circumstances for students who were unable to complete the University's standard withdrawal process during the semester. If approved, a retroactive withdrawal results in a grade of "W" for all courses taken during the approved semester.

Eligibility

Students may request a retroactive withdrawal only if they meet the eligible criteria:

  • A serious illness or injury that significantly limited the student's ability to complete the withdrawal process.
  • A health or safety emergency involving an immediate family member.
  • A permanent disability that was diagnosed after the semester in question, verified by the Office of Accessibility Services, and determined to be relevant to the withdrawal request.
  • Other documented extenuating circumstances.

Application requirements

 

 

To be considered, students must:

  • Complete the Retroactive Withdrawal Application in its entirety.
  • Include a detailed statement explaining the circumstances surrounding the request.
  • Submit supporting documentation that verifies the reason for the request.

Incomplete applications or applications submitted without supporting documentation cannot be reviewed.

submission deadline

All retroactive withdrawal requests must be submitted within 30 business days of the last day of the final examination period for the semester in which the student was enrolled. Please refer to the University's published Academic Calendar for semester-specific dates.

Request from military eligible students are exempt from the submission deadline.

review process

The Retroactive Withdrawal Committee reviews all completed applications and supporting documentation. Applicants will receive a written decision within 10 business days after the committee has received a complete application.

The decision of the Retroactive Withdrawal Committee is final and non-appealable.
